Understanding the Venue

Before diving into the ticket-buying process,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the venue. The Falcons play their home games at Mercedes-Benz Stadium in Atlanta, Georgia, a state-of-the-art facility that offers an unparalleled viewing experience. With its retractable roof and massive video board, every seat in the house provides an immersive experience. However, some seats are undoubtedly better than others, offering closer proximity to the action, better sightlines, and even access to exclusive amenities like gourmet dining and lounge areas.

Breaking Down the Seating Chart

Mercedes-Benz Stadium’s seating chart is divided into several levels, each with its unique characteristics and advantages. - Lower Level Seats: These seats offer the closest proximity to the field, providing an intense and immersive experience. Sections near the 50-yard line (e.g., Sections 108-112 and 134-138) are particularly sought after for their centralized view of the action. - Club Level Seats: Located just above the lower level, these seats provide excellent views of the field while also offering access to upscale amenities like restaurants, bars, and lounges. The club level is divided into sections like C108-C112 and C134-C138, mirroring the lower level’s layout. - Upper Level Seats: For those on a budget or looking for a broader view of the field, upper level seats are a viable option. Though farther from the action, these seats still offer a great perspective on the game, especially those closer to the 50-yard line.

Ticket Buying Strategies

Securing the best seats for a Falcons vs. Steelers game requires a combination of strategy, flexibility, and sometimes a bit of luck. Here are a few approaches to consider: - Official Team Websites and Ticket Offices: The official websites of the Falcons and Steelers, as well as the ticket office at Mercedes-Benz Stadium, often have tickets available, including season tickets, single-game tickets, and premium seating options. Be prepared to act quickly, as these tickets can sell out rapidly. - Authorized Resale Platforms: Sites like StubHub, SeatGeek, and Vivid Seats offer a wide selection of tickets from verified sellers. These platforms often provide filters and seating charts to help you find the perfect seats based on your preferences and budget. - Secondary Marketplaces: For those looking for a more personalized experience or unique seating options, consider exploring secondary marketplaces or fan-to-fan resale platforms. However, exercise caution and ensure you’re purchasing from a reputable source to avoid scams.

How early should I arrive at Mercedes-Benz Stadium for a Falcons game?

+

Aim to arrive at least 2 hours before kickoff to account for security checks, parking, and getting to your seat. This also gives you time to enjoy the pre-game atmosphere and perhaps grab a bite to eat or visit the team store.

What are the best seats for seeing the entire field at Mercedes-Benz Stadium?

+

Seats near the 50-yard line on the lower and club levels offer the best views of the entire field. However, upper-level seats closer to the 50-yard line can also provide a great panoramic view of the action, often at a lower price point.

Can I purchase tickets on the day of the game?

+

Yes, but availability and prices may vary significantly. It's advisable to purchase tickets in advance through official channels or authorized resale platforms to ensure you get the best seats at a fair price.
